About Viktor

Viktor is the AI teammate. It lives in Slack and Microsoft Teams, connects to thousands of tools, and does real work for real companies: finance, marketing, ops, engineering. We're building the product that replaces half the SaaS stack.

The team is small. The scope is not.

 
The Short Version

You're the person who answers when a customer's AI teammate misbehaves. Fast, in writing, with a real diagnosis. Support at Viktor isn't a ticket queue; it's the sensor network of the company. You fix the customer's problem, then you map the pattern behind it and hand product a trend they can act on.

This is an on-site role, based in our Warsaw or Dublin office.

 
What's Actually Going On Here

Viktor is growing faster than our support capacity, and our recent Microsoft Teams launch is adding load. We need people who can hold quality while volume climbs: reproduce issues, read logs, write bug reports engineers act on the same day, and tell trends apart from noise. The tooling is scrappy and the problems are novel; an AI agent "getting something wrong" takes real curiosity to diagnose.

 
What You'll Actually Do
  • Own tier-1 support: triage, reproduce, resolve or escalate with a clean repro.

  • Read logs, test workarounds, and write bug reports engineering acts on without a follow-up question.

  • Turn ticket noise into trend maps that feed product. This mandate is explicit, not aspirational.

  • Help customers understand agent behaviour they can't articulate themselves.

  • Improve the machine as you go: docs, macros, self-serve fixes.

 
How You'll Know It's Working
  • Response and resolution times hold as volume grows.

  • Engineering ships fixes against issues you scoped.

  • Product decisions reference patterns you spotted first.

 
Who You Are
  • 2 to 5 years in technical support at a SaaS or AI company, or an equivalent track record you can show.

  • Outstanding written English. Most of this job is writing, and our customers notice the difference.

  • Technical enough to reproduce issues, read logs, and hold your own in an engineering conversation.

  • AI-native: you lean on AI daily for triage, reproduction and drafting, or you've supported an AI product. You'll ramp faster and diagnose agent-behaviour issues others can't.

  • Genuinely curious about how things break. Comfortable in a scrappy tooling environment.

 
Probably Not a Fit If
  • You follow scripts.

  • Ambiguity stresses you out.

  • You can't tell a customer "I don't know yet, here's when you'll hear from me."

 
Even Better If
  • You've supported an AI or agent product before.

  • You've written docs or help-center content that measurably deflected tickets.

  • You can read code, even if you don't write it daily.
